Queen Elizabeth's funeral: How did the day unfold?

In the first funeral of its kind since 1952, Britain has laid to rest its longest-living monarch, Queen Elizabeth II.World leaders and mourners from across the globe gathered in Westminster Abbey for a royal state funeral, in a ceremony not seen since the death of the Queen's father, King George VI.Steeped in tradition, it was a day filled with many symbolic gestures and movements, from the conclusion of the Queen's lying-in-state, to the committal service at St George's Chapel.
